Raoul Dufy (1877-1953) - Baigneuse dans le port de Sainte-Adresse
\Artist: Raoul Dufy (1877-1953)
Technique: Lithograph\Signature: Hand signed
Hand signed and dedicated lithograph "Epreuve pour M. Landel" by Raoul DUFY, Sheet size: 46 x 57 cm Illustration size out: 33 x 44 cm Plate part of the suite "La Mer” circa 1933. Some stains in the margin. He painted a lot around Le Havre, especially on the beach of Sainte-Adresse made famous by Eugène Boudin and Claude Monet. One of the great painters of the 20th century, inspired by Impressionism, then Fauvism and then Cubism before imposing his own style especially with watercolour and gouache. His paintings are sought after by amateurs all over the world, Exhibited in the greatest museums.
